M919 Fake Cache and Reproduction L2 COASt Modules
Recently I got this Quantex 486DX computer with a PC Chips/Alpina M919 v3.3B/F motherboard. Turns out it's infamous for having fraudulent Level 2 cache! A few companies were doing some shady crap back in the day with fake/dummy cache chips. Not only that, but it goes so far as to lie and say that the cache is *actually* working when it's not, and apparently there's even some kind of lockout where you can only use their proprietary 256K COASt module. Wow... Luckily, a modern reproduction of the M919 256K cache stick exists and I've got one. Let's try it out!
